8-bit, dual 4-bit buffer/line driver with true outputs. Features 3-state outputs, non-inverting logic, and BIPOLAR technology. Operates from a 4.75V to 5.25V supply voltage with a typical 5V operating voltage. Offers a high level output current of -15mA and a low level output current of 64mA. Surface mountable in a 20-pin SOIC package with a 9ns propagation delay.
